Ok so I had a bit of a pain the in the bum with the engine in this car. :cry:

Over the last couple of days it has used a bit of water, power is down, and is venting much more exhaust gas out of the rocker cover breather than it should be. I suspect that the head gasket has failed but would not know for sure unless it was stripped down to see.

Here's the deal, I need the car gone as I have something else lined up so am offering it to anyone who is interested for £1695.00 for the car as it is. I'm sure there is much more value in the parts if I were to break the car but it seem such a shame to break the car with all the rare JDM parts.

RattyMcClelland wrote:I didnt think that matters on low boost like below 10psi. But on higher boost alot of guys get new breather holes welded in the front of the cover.
No definitely cant have the air intake (non pcv valve side) of the breather plumbed into the intake as under boost the whole thing would pressurise. The reason why high boost turbo people run larger crank case breather is just because they need to vent more air to atmosphere so the more holes the better.
